In response to Tom’s comment, here’s how I got everyone. Many of them I picked in the draft before they were superstars and kept them.

Alex Rodriguez: I took him with the third pick in the first round of our first keeper draft in 2001 (after Pedro and Randy Johnson). I’ve kept him since that draft.

Vladimir Guerrero: I took him with the third pick in the third round of that 2001 draft and kept him since.

Bobby Abreu: I took him in the fourth round of the 2001 draft and have kept him since.

Jeff Bagwell: Acquired via trade for Paul Konerko and Carlos Lee during the 2002 season and kept since then.

Rafael Furcal: Drafted in the 14th round of the 2003 draft and kept last year.

Tim Hudson: I traded for Mike Mussina in the 2001 season, then traded Mussina and a closer for Hudson. I’ve kept Hudson since then.

Pedro Martinez: I traded JD Drew in a deal for Brian Giles in 2001, then traded Giles straight up for Pedro at the All-Star break in 2002. This was when Pedro was having arm trouble and looked to be almost out of baseball. I’ve kept him since.

Barry Zito: Drafted in the 9th round of the 2001 draft (when he’d only pitched a half a season), then traded for Troy Glaus at the end of 2001 and reacquired in a deal for Cliff Floyd before the 2002 season and kept since.

Curt Schilling: Traded Matt Morris (drafted in the 22nd round in 2001 and kept until the trade) and Austin Kearns for him during the the stretch run last year and kept him.

Johan Santana: Free agent pickup last season.
